“Did it strike you as amusing that NBC’s Beirut bureau chief Richard Engel wasn’t even in Beirut for the start of the story?,” an e-mailer asks. Well, come to think of it, yes.

David Verdi says Engel was in Gaza covering another part of the story. As a result, ABC’s David Wright and FNC’s Greg Burke both had a nice head start — they flew into the city on Wednesday. Engel drove into Beirut on Thursday in time for NBC Nightly News. Other correspondent deployments:

FNC: Mike Tobin at the northern border between Israel and Lebanon, David Lee Miller in Gaza, Amy Kellogg in Jerusalem, Jennifer Griffin in Israel (via ICN)…

CNN: Anderson Cooper in Israel, Nic Robertson and Alessio Vinci in Beirut, John Vause at the northern border of Israel and Lebanon, Ben Wedeman in the Gaza Strip, Paula Hancocks in Safed, Israel, and Paula Newton in Jerusalem. Christiane Amanpour will be in Jerusalem on Sunday (via CNN P.R.)…

NBC: Fred Francis in Gaza City, Martin Fletcher in Israel; who else?…

ABC: Wilf Dinnick in Northern Israel, Dan Harris in Israel. Harris was returning from South Korea to New York; he was redirected to the Middle East…

CBS: Richard Roth along the northern border, Lara Logan in Israel, Elizabeth Palmer in Beirut…

Now the nets are positioning correspondents in Syria. CNN’s Baghdad correspondent Aneesh Raman is in Damascus, and ABC’s Nick Watt is en route…
